PARENTS AND FAMILY ACTIVITY GUIDES
Benjamin Harrison Society (BHS) offers parents and family guides which are designed to be informative (teaching the importance of  preserving and understanding cultural heritage), engaging (providing hands-on activities that allow our children  to act and think like archaeologists), and cross-curricular (bringing together skills required in geography, engineering, arts, and reading (the GEARS Project) together with science, social science/history, arts, and language).
